Recent studies suggest that AhR, known as dioxin receptor, is associated with glucose and lipid metabolism. Therefore, in this study, we examined the role of AhR on energy metabolism in the liver specific knockout AhR (L-AhR KO) mice. AhR LKO mice resulted in the elevation of insulin sensitivity, leading to the decrease in the ratio of body weigh gain. The reduction of food intake in AhR LKO mice resulted from the elevated serum leptin level and the increased leptin signaling in the hypothalamus. Deficiency of leptin abolished these effects in AhR LKO mice. Therefore, these results suggest that hepatic AhR is a novel factor in the regulation of energy metabolism through the modulation of leptin level.
